Key statistics show job openings little changed nationally at 7.4 million in June 2025 according to BLS JOLTS, while local hires and separations rates are stable. Trends indicate cooling wage growth at 4.5 percent year-over-year per ADP, with job hopping premiums vanishing except in construction and mining. Unemployment in Atlanta metro sits below the national average, buoyed by healthcare adding thousands of roles monthly.
Major industries include aerospace, film production, and fintech, where Georgia ranks high with firms like those listed by Atlanta Business Chronicle. Growing sectors are artificial intelligence and software, with companies like SOLTECH and Simform expanding AI development per Clutch rankings. Recent developments feature Euna Solutions opening its Atlanta headquarters in Sandy Springs and the record 2026 IPPE expo drawing 32,550 attendees for poultry and food processing jobs. Seasonal patterns show construction peaks in warmer months, while commuting trends favor hybrid work reducing downtown traffic, though evictions hit 144,000 amid housing pressures per Eviction Lab.
Government initiatives via Georgia's workforce programs support tech training, evolving the market toward AI and green energy. Data gaps exist on Atlanta-specific JOLTS post-June 2025, with state estimates due July 2026.
Key findings highlight stabilization in a softening market, AI growth opportunities, and construction demand. Current openings include AI developer at SOLTECH in Atlanta, custom software engineer at Synergy Labs, and fintech analyst roles at top Georgia firms.
